Cloud cover builds this morning, setting the stage for light snow to arrive by the afternoon as early fog slowly clears. The snow tapers off this evening, giving way to colder air and clearing skies overnight. Sunshine dominates Wednesday and Thursday, though brisk winds and crisp mornings keep conditions feeling wintry. A brief warmup arrives Friday and Saturday with more sunshine and only occasional cloud cover. Cooler air returns Sunday and early next week, bringing a chance of flurries back into the forecast.
